Swamper: Actually, the sounds aren't stored in the AB file. Just like every other sound, they are XA files in sound.dat. The .abk files only connect driving parameters to their respective sounds. All you'd need to do would be to find the proper XA files and replace them. You'd just have to comb through them all. Oh, wait - try checking the IIDs referenced in the Ambulance's SFX properties. overlordr1: This should do: https://www.simtropolis.com/stex/index.cfm?mode=files&filetype=Lot&Str=beach%20modd I use the Grass beach in my Chicago. Whoops. I didn't notice your other thread (coming back from a trip today). So you haven't had success with the DeepEx method. Make sure you only export frame 1 of your gmax scene. Also, it will export all hidden objects. If you don't want these objects, delete them. If you do, copy them into another scene and then delete them from the first. Make sure you only have mesh objects in your scenes. Delete the helper objects and everything else. As I said, materials come out all messed up. You might have to re-do these. UV coordinates remain the same, tho - you only have to re-do the stuff in the Material Editor. I use this method quite often. As long as you tidy up your gmax scenes carefully, it should work great.
